    Once you've checked your coil for hotspots, etc. and it's at ambient temp you should remeasure for the 'cold ohm' value. You should only need to do that again if you change to a different profile. And you very very rarely ever should need to lock your ohms.

    didn't understand the majority of this, but 300°C is the limit on these mods.

    No idea what you mean for #1
    #2. No, I don't think you need preheat at all. But if you do, the 'preheat power' (75W in your case BUT disabled) should be > 'power set' (60W in your case). And it's much easier to use the slider (1-11) compared to temp unless you know the temps that your specific juice components aerosolize at. That slider says how close your coil gets to that 'Temperature set' value (220°C in your case) before ending preheat
